    Here's my new setup, I moved the taskbar to the top right corner, where it overlaps any windows. I moved the close/maximize/minimize buttons to the left side of the title bar, allowing any maximized windows to only go under the taskbar where the title bar is usually blank. The KMenu/Trash/System Tray/Clock on the bottom right and the System Menu on the bottom left autohide, and appear when I move the mouse to those edges of the screen.
